About N-benzyl-2-chloroquinazolin-4-amine
N-benzyl-2-chloroquinazolin-4-amine (PubChem CID 139086535) has the molecular formula C30H24Cl2N6
and a molecular weight of 539.47 g/mol. Its IUPAC name is N-benzyl-2-chloroquinazolin-4-amine.
